**Mgmt Meeting Minutes — Retiring the Brightline Range**

Quick recap for sales leads at Fenholt Supplies: we agreed to retire the Brightline fixture range by year-end. Remaining stock moves to clearance pricing next month, and accounts on standing orders get migrated to the Lumetta range. Trade-in incentives were approved in principle. The confidential note on next steps sits just below.

board note of bajof-bajeg: The pricing group signed off on a budget of $13.4 million for Project Sildor. The renewal with Lamixek Holdings closes at $48.9 million a year, 49 percent above the last contract.

So the Murmura app's gallery nodes have drifted again. The east wing server is serving stale tour manifests because someone hand-edited its cache settings back in spring and never committed the change. Playback timeouts also differ between nodes, which explains the intermittent "track unavailable" reports from the Hollowgate Museum staff. Future maintainers: please always change config through the repo, never on-box. To get everything back in sync, reset each node to the canonical values below.

service settings:
[casax]
port = 6379
team = rusir
host = casax.zemvarhq.corp
region = outer-4
access_code = ac_9808ce
timeout_ms = 1500

## Authentication

The relevance-tuning notebook in this repo talks to Rankery, our internal search-tuning service, to pull query logs and push boost configs. Nothing fancy — one bearer key, read/write on the tuning namespace only. Reviewers: run the notebook end-to-end before approving weight changes. The key for the staging instance is below.

service key, fawip-bajef: kto11_Qt5wZK9vdNC

Ticket #4417 — Shared lab, Building C. The Marrowgate team next door now shares Lab C-3 with us through end of quarter. Reception: their staff may collect loaner badges without a sponsor, max four at a time. Log names on the shared-lab sheet. Return badges by 18:00 daily. Lab door uses a separate reader; issue the code below with each badge.

door code, yagap-bahof: bdg-O-05